How To Fix RSPLPPM129 - Planning session (plan) &1 not found in master data for characteristic &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RSPLPPM - Message Class for Package RSPLPPM

  • Message number: 129

  • Message text: Planning session (plan) &1 not found in master data for characteristic &2

    The SAP error message RSPLPPM129 indicates that a planning session (plan) specified in the system is not found in the master data for a particular characteristic. This error typically occurs in the context of SAP BW (Business Warehouse) or SAP Integrated Business Planning (IBP) when working with planning functions or planning sequences.

    Cause:

    1. Missing Planning Session: The specified planning session does not exist in the master data for the characteristic you are trying to use.
    2. Incorrect Characteristic: The characteristic specified in the error message may not be correctly defined or may not be linked to the planning session.
    3.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the master data or planning data that prevent the system from recognizing the planning session.
    4.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the planning session or the associated master data.

    Solution:

    1. Check Planning Session: Verify that the planning session (plan) exists in the system. You can do this by navigating to the relevant planning area or using transaction codes like RSPLPPM to manage planning sessions.
    2. Validate Characteristic: Ensure that the characteristic specified in the error message is correctly defined and is part of the planning session. Check the configuration of the planning area and the characteristics associated with it.
    3. Recreate or Adjust Planning Session: If the planning session is missing, you may need to recreate it or adjust the existing one to include the necessary characteristics.
    4. Check Master Data: Ensure that the master data for the characteristic is complete and consistent. You may need to refresh or update the master data if there are discrepancies.
    5. Authorization Check: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the planning session and the associated data. You may need to consult with your SAP security team to ensure proper access rights.
